2015 Fianchetto
2015 Fianchetto

Winemaker Notes:  XL vineyard consistently produces wines of intense concentration and structure.The 2015 Fianchetto wine has a deep ruby-purple color with a redolent bouquet of ripe black currant, blackberry, black plum, violet, gravel, and cigar tobacco on the bouquet. The full-bodied palate is very complex with precise notes of cassis, black cherry, gravel, cigar tobacco, incense, espresso, vanilla, and dark chocolate. Gentle herbal tones of dried thyme, lavender, and mint add significant interest to the core of fruit. The finish is very long with well delineated notes of cigar tobacco, violets, cedar, and cassis. An exquisitely balanced wine with high dry extract, firm tannic structure, and nervy acidity. Properly cellared, this wine should reach maturity in 8-10 years and drink well for 20+ years.

Fermentation: The wine had a pre-fermentation maceration of 152 hours. 100% native fermentation. The wine was punched down by hand 3 times each day during maceration and fermentation. All individual wine components, including free run and press fractions, were kept separate until final blending.

Cooperage: Elevage was 28 months in 80% new French oak from Troncais. After bottling the wine was aged in our cellar for 36 months prior to release. The wine achieved its sparkly brilliance from 4 judicious rackings, no fining agents were employed. The wine was very gently filtered using crossflow filtration.

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, 92 Points - Dark red-ruby. Aromas of cassis, black cherry, dark raspberry, licorice and bitter chocolate complemented by sexy spicy oak tones. Fine-grained, very ripe and classically dry, combining serious alcoholic clout and surprising energy. Plush, concentrated red berry flavors are lifted by a floral element that's rare for such a ripe Bordeaux blend. This powerful wine finishes with broad, dusty tannins and serious sweetness. Constant wind at this site typically results in small, thick-skinned berries, and Naravane noted that the tannins here can easily get out of whack. He presses the wine before it's fully dry and allows the fermentation to finish in barrels. (15.3% alcohol; aged for 28 months in 80% new Tronçais oak)
